Cartogiraffe.com

Horse and Groom Lane

Horse and Groom Lane is an illuminated street with a maximum speed of 30 mph in Chelmsford.

Pin to show location on the map Horse and Groom Lane

type of road
non-specified
Maximum speed
30 mph